| Objective:To investigate the thickness of the roof of the glenoid fossa of the normal temporomandibular joint by CBCT among Chinese youth population in order to provide theoretical guidance for fossa arthroplasty in computer aided navigation surgery of temporomandibular jointankylosis.Methods:132 volunteers(264 nomal temporomandibular joints)were selected and undergone large field of view CBCT scans.After 3D reconstruction with image processing software,the thickness at the thinnest part of the roof of mandibular glenoid fossa was identified and measured in both coronal and sagittal views and the results were statistically analyzed according to joint side,gender and age.Results:Four sets of measurements of the thickness of the roof of the glenoid fossa were obtained for each individual;Significant differences between two genders(P<0.05),the thickness of the roof of glenoid fossa of both two sides in both coronal and sagittal views was higher in male than female;There were significant differences between two sides in coronal view in all individuals(P<0.05),the thickness of the left glenoid fossa roof was greater than the right,no difference between two sides in sagittal view(P>0.05);No significant difference between different age groups in both male and female samples(P>0.05).Conclusion:In the preoperative planning for temporomandibular joint ankylosis surgery using navigation system,the measurements of the thickness of the roof of the normal temporomandibular glenoid fossa for the unilateral TMJ ankylosis is a significant reference in clinic.normal temporomandibular fossa roof and age. |
